International Airport Development – Bangui
Strategic Objectives
Africa Contractor and Investment (ACI) is spearheading the development of a new international airport in Bangui, Central African Republic — a transformative project designed to serve as both a gateway to the nation and a strategic transportation hub for the entire Central African region.
Boost Regional Connectivity: The airport will significantly improve the region’s accessibility, connecting Bangui directly to major African capitals, European cities, and global commercial routes.
Support Economic Development: With its logistics and cargo capabilities, the airport will facilitate trade and attract foreign investment, supporting local businesses and creating new jobs.
Enhance National Image and Sovereignty: A world-class airport symbolizes stability and ambition. It reflects a vision of progress and modernity while reinforcing the country’s diplomatic and geopolitical presence.
Key Features
Modern Passenger Terminal with cutting-edge facilities for customs, immigration, and baggage handling
Cargo and Logistics Hub to boost regional exports and streamline supply chains
Runways and Navigation Systems compliant with ICAO (International Civil Aviation Organization) standards
Commercial Zones for shops, business centers, and hospitality services
Sustainable Construction integrating eco-friendly materials and energy-efficient systems
